今天写了一个代码,但是输入数据都输入不进去!!
例如:需要输入A 1 2,这三个字符,我一开始用了scanf(“%c %c %c", &a , &b, &c);
然后调试的时候发现根本读入不正确,然后动脑子想了一下,空格这也是一种字符,会被读入啊!
因为scanf(“%c %c %c", &a , &b, &c);这句话的效果跟scanf(“%c%c%c", &a , &b, &c);的效果一样啊!
所以又用了cin >> a >> b >> c;成功读入数据!
今天写了一个代码,但是输入数据都输入不进去!!
例如:需要输入A 1 2,这三个字符,我一开始用了scanf(“%c %c %c", &a , &b, &c);
然后调试的时候发现根本读入不正确,然后动脑子想了一下,空格这也是一种字符,会被读入啊!
因为scanf(“%c %c %c", &a , &b, &c);这句话的效果跟scanf(“%c%c%c", &a , &b, &c);的效果一样啊!
所以又用了cin >> a >> b >> c;成功读入数据!